联翼布局多控制面纵向配平特性研究
引用本文:李军,李占科,宋笔锋.联翼布局多控制面纵向配平特性研究[J].飞行力学,2010,28(2).
作者姓名:李军  李占科  宋笔锋
作者单位:西北工业大学,航空学院,陕西,西安,710072
摘    要:采用多控制面配平是联翼布局临近空间长航时无人机提高升阻比、延长航时、降低起飞重量的重要措施。针对某联翼布局的临近空间长航时无人机,利用CFD计算和工程估算相结合的方式,研究了其多控制面纵向配平时的气动特性和对起飞重量的影响。结果表明,采用多控制面设计并选择合适的配平模式,可以保证在良好的配平姿态和配平纵向静稳定性下,有效提高配平升阻比,降低起飞重量。

关 键 词:联翼  临近空间长航时  多控制面  纵向配平特性
